Introduction to 2-3 Trees

A 2-3 Tree is a tree data structure where every node with children has either two children and one data element or three children and two data elements. A node with 2 children is called a 2-NODE and a node with 3 children is called a 3-NODE. A 4-NODE, with three data elements, may be temporarily created during manipulation of the tree but is never persistently stored in the tree.
